13 # Run without arguments, commitid.scad.pl will output an openscad file
14 # which contains 2D and 3D models of the current git commit count and
15 # commit object id (commit hash), useful for identifying printed

81 # General form of provided openscad modules
82 # -----------------------------------------
84 # module Commitid_MODULE_2D(...) Collection of polygons forming characters
85 # module Commitid_MODULE(...) The above, extruded up and down in Z
86 # module Commitid_MODULE_M_2D(...) Mirror writing
87 # module Commitid_MODULE_M(...) 3D mirror writing
88 # function Commitid_MODULE_sz() A 2-vector giving the X,Y size
90 # Except for *Best* modules, the XY origin is in the bottom left
91 # corner without any margin. Likewise Commitid_MODULE_sz does not
94 # For 3D versions, the model is 2*depth deep and the XY plane bisects
95 # the model. This means it's convenient to either add or subtract from
96 # a workpiece whose face is in the XY plane.
98 # The _M versions are provided to avoid doing inconvenient translation
99 # and rotation to get the flipped version in the right place.
102 # Autoscaling modules
103 # -------------------
105 # These modules take a specification of the available XY space, and
106 # select and generate a suitable specific identification layout:
108 # module Commitid_BestCount_2D (max_sz, margin=Commitid_pixelsz())
109 # module Commitid_BestCount (max_sz, margin=Commitid_pixelsz())
110 # module Commitid_BestCount_M_2D(max_sz, margin=Commitid_pixelsz())
111 # module Commitid_BestCount_M (max_sz, margin=Commitid_pixelsz())
112 # module Commitid_BestObjid_2D (max_sz, margin=Commitid_pixelsz())
113 # module Commitid_BestObjid (max_sz, margin=Commitid_pixelsz())
114 # module Commitid_BestObjid_M_2D(max_sz, margin=Commitid_pixelsz())
115 # module Commitid_BestObjid_M (max_sz, margin=Commitid_pixelsz())
117 # max_sz should be [x,y].
119 # BestCount includes (as much as it can of) the git commit count,
121 # git rev-list --first-parent --count HEAD
122 # (and it may include some of the git revision ID too).
124 # BestObjid includes as much as it can of the git commit object hash,
125 # and never includes any of the count.
127 # All of these will autoscale and autorotate the selected model, and
128 # will include an internal margin of the specified size (by default,
129 # one pixel around each edge). If no margin is needed, pass margin=0.
131 # There are no `function Commitid_Best*_sz'. If they existed they
132 # would simply return max_sz.
138 # In general the output, although it may be over multiple lines,
139 # is always in this order
140 # git commit object id (hash)
144 # Not all layouts have all these parts. The commit object id may
145 # sometimes be split over multiple lines, but the count will not be.
146 # If both commit id and commit count appear they will be separated
147 # by (at least) a newline, or a dirty indicator, or a space.
149 # The commit id is truncated to fit, from the right.
151 # The commit count is truncated from the _left_, leaving the least
152 # significant decimal digits.
154 # The dirty indicator can be
156 # * meaning the working tree contains differences from HEAD
158 # + meaning the working tree contains untracked files
159 # (ie files you have failed to `git add' and also failed
160 # to add to gitignore). (But see the -i option.)

668 # Auto-computer for `best fit'
670 # We have two best fit approaches: with count, and git-object-id-only
672 # For `with count', we only ever include the git object id if the
673 # result would be unambigous. That means that at least one space
674 # or punctuation was generated.
676 # We sort the options by firstly number of characters
677 # (decreasing), and then by number of lines (increasing) and
678 # try each one both ways round.
